diff options
author | Travis A. Everett <travis.a.everett@gmail.com> | 2020-05-27 19:04:55 -0500 |
---|---|---|
committer | Frederik Rietdijk <freddyrietdijk@fridh.nl> | 2020-06-14 08:55:24 +0200 |
commit | e0ac44ef45212aadb4ef320dfe5560d4b8fa90de (patch) | |
tree | 68287a45cfcca6bcd4f2d3089c732d66e827ad25 | |
parent | 8bbc4b0361fbf103eb293bf229368aebc83192b3 (diff) | |
download | nixpkgs-e0ac44ef45212aadb4ef320dfe5560d4b8fa90de.tar nixpkgs-e0ac44ef45212aadb4ef320dfe5560d4b8fa90de.tar.gz nixpkgs-e0ac44ef45212aadb4ef320dfe5560d4b8fa90de.tar.bz2 nixpkgs-e0ac44ef45212aadb4ef320dfe5560d4b8fa90de.tar.lz nixpkgs-e0ac44ef45212aadb4ef320dfe5560d4b8fa90de.tar.xz nixpkgs-e0ac44ef45212aadb4ef320dfe5560d4b8fa90de.tar.zst nixpkgs-e0ac44ef45212aadb4ef320dfe5560d4b8fa90de.zip |
findutils: fix undeclared xargs dep on echo
When invoked without a command parameter, xargs runs echo from PATH. This change patches xargs to use a specific Nix-built echo.
-rw-r--r-- | pkgs/tools/misc/findutils/default.nix |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/pkgs/tools/misc/findutils/default.nix b/pkgs/tools/misc/findutils/default.nix index 1b69b80be70..230e401ef82 100644 --- a/pkgs/tools/misc/findutils/default.nix +++ b/pkgs/tools/misc/findutils/default.nix @@ -11,6 +11,10 @@ stdenv.mkDerivation rec { sha256 = "16kqz9yz98dasmj70jwf5py7jk558w96w0vgp3zf9xsqk3gzpzn5"; }; + postPatch = '' + substituteInPlace xargs/xargs.c --replace 'char default_cmd[] = "echo";' 'char default_cmd[] = "${coreutils}/bin/echo";' + ''; + patches = [ ./no-install-statedir.patch ]; |